"CapiTel is a multi-threaded 32-Bit Answering Machine. There are graphical and text-mode versions available for OS/2 (ISDN CAPI 1.1 and CAPI 2.0) and Windows 95, 98, Millenium, NT 4.0 and 2000 (ISDN CAPI 2.0). A list of supported languages and the latest versions themselves can be found in the files section."
Now it is released as open source software under the GNU GPL license.
